This essential book on Raphael traces the evolution of his career from its origins in central Italy to the prestigious patronage of Pope Julius II in Rome.

About the Author:
Hugo Chapman is Assistant Keeper of Prints and Drawings at the British Museum. Tom Henry is an independent scholar. Carol Plazzotta is Myojin Curator of Italian Renaissance Painting 1500?1600 at the National Gallery, London.
